Will Cardona’s snap speed have any impact on the kicking game? I’ve heard one of the reasons against long FG attempts is that with the distance the kicker has to cover, by the time the snap is down, the defenders are on top of the ball. Will having a snap that gets back so quickly make any noticeable difference in FG attempts?

August 14, 2015 by Mike Dussault

Wow I never even thought about that but it makes some sense. We’ll see if they’re more willing to try some long ones this year.

And how about Cardona getting no credit for just stepping in and doing a great job last night. We always take long snappers for granted until they rocket one over the punter/kicker’s head. 

I’m sure he’ll get some attention this season, but for now he’s strangely way under the rookie radar.

Updated Patriots Depth Chart (post-Preseason Game One)

I don’t want to get too crazy and read too much into how guys were being played last night, but I do think we got some clarity on positional specificity like Rufus Johnson being at defensive end and Xzavier Dickson playing more linebacker.

One significant change is moving Brandon Gibson to the top of the X WR depth chart. I am curious to see how he looks next week with Brady and more of the real offense. But unless Dobson comes roaring back, Gibson has the inside track on the #4 WR spot.

Juggled the DTs a bit as well. I had them as DT and NT but I think there’s just so much crossover now it makes sense to just label them both DT. Antonio Johnson is at the top right now but I don’t know how firm that is. Alan Branch could knock him off once completely in shape.

Thoughts on Boyce and Ryan?

August 14, 2015 by Mike Dussault

I think Ryan is what we thought he was –  a slot corner with some outside versatility but probably not a guy who’s going to project to a long term starter. As I said yesterday, these were vanilla defenses and they played quite a bit of man, not exactly Ryan’s specialty. I think he’s fine, he’ll just likely remain in his role from last year as the fourth corner.

I’ve never really been enamored with Boyce and last night just reinforced every average feeling I’ve ever had about him. Last night was probably his last chance to shine unfortunately. He just doesn’t really seem to fit into the offense in a way that maximizes his strengths. Most obvious is that his play speed is not up to his timed speed. He has no zip and gives no defender problems with any particular skill set.

I think Brandon Gibson is now my favorite at the 4th WR spot, with whoever can get healthy first between Tyms and Dobson at the 5th spot. I’d give Tyms a slight inside edge due to special teams ability.

Am I the only one who doesn’t see any explosiveness and elusiveness in James White? Vereen was silky smooth and could use subtle head nods and planting skills to elude defenders, I just don’t see it with White… he can’t run anywhere after contact either… his body is uber slim and his stride isn’t fast, he just doesn’t seem like the type of guy that can be split out white and create favorable matchips, yet carry the ball for more than a yard… Had to get that off my mind, any thoughts?

August 14, 2015 by Mike Dussault

I can’t entirely disagree. I did think he showed some good moves in the open field a couple times, but yes, I still like Vereen, Woodhead and Faulk more than I like White at this point. (Still wish we’d held on to Woodhead)

This is why after last night, I think the plan will be to replace Vereen with a combination of Cadet and White, not just one of them carrying the load, at least in the early part of the season.

Cadet has better size than any of those guys and could add a very different dynamic of a physical receiving back that we haven’t really seen before. In that context, having a change of pace, small/quick guy like White would be complimentary.

And let’s remember, White hasn’t played a game in a year. He’s better mentally now in the system, but physically he still needs to get his feel for true contact back.

Add in Bolden as well who can catch the ball and it’s a pretty solid group. It just might take time for one guy to emerge above the others, if anyone even does.
